Position Purpose:

Under general supervision, fabricates aircraft furniture and other wood-surfaced subassemblies using aircraft specifications, design and engineering drawings with a high level of safety, quality, detail and productivity. Assists team members with greater experience to enhance techniques supportive of quality workmanship.

Job Description

Principle Duties and Responsibilities:

Essential Functions:
- Works under general supervision to fabricate furniture and other wood-surfaced subassemblies using blueprints, aircraft specifications and design/engineering drawings.

- Assembles, pins and glues cabinet shells. Installs drawer-slides, hinges, latches and other hardware in subassemblies. Applies exterior surface materials such as laminates, veneers, and cap strips.

- Uses various types of stationary and hand-held power tools to fabricate or disassemble furniture.

- Complies with all safety, 5S, and housekeeping policies. Uses personal protective equipment to protect aircraft interior.

- Uses the material tracking system to create parts demand, track squawks and to sign-off work.
